Detail: deterministic ordering in --brief --verbose

Have mdadm --Detail --brief --verbose print the list of devices in
alphabetical order.

This is useful for debugging purposes. E.g. the test script
10ddf-create compares the output of two mdadm -Dbv calls which
may be different if the order is not deterministic.

(I confess: I use a modified "test" script that always runs
"mdadm --verbose" rather than "mdadm --quiet", otherwise this
wouldn't happen in 10ddf-create).
